ACT Wins Platinum Award for High Efficiency ECU

Friday, September 9, 2022– Advanced Cooling Technologies, Inc. announced today that its High EER ECU was recognized among the best by the 2022 Military + Aerospace Electronics Innovators Awards. An esteemed and experienced panel of judges from the aerospace and defense community recognized Advanced Cooling Technologies, Inc as a Platinum honoree.

ACT ECU Platinum Award Winner!
ACT has developed a high energy efficiency ratio (EER) ECU to minimize electrical energy consumption for applications that require improved efficiency.

“On behalf of the Military + Aerospace Electronics Innovators Awards, I would like to congratulate Advanced Cooling Technologies, on their Platinum–level honoree status,” said Military + Aerospace Electronics Editor in Chief John Keller. “This competitive program allows Military + Aerospace Electronics to celebrate and recognize the most innovative products impacting the aerospace and defense community this year.”

Historically, energy efficiency for environmental control units (ECUs) has not been a major consideration for most military applications. In a lot of cases, the cooling system can rely on shore power which poses minimal threat to most military operations if the energy consumption of the cooling equipment is sub-optimal. More recently, there is a substantial push for military equipment to become more mobile and deployable where electrical power sources are derived from fossil fuel-burning generators. In these applications improving energy efficiency can play a significant role in saving the lives of soldiers. Fuel convoys are often targeted by the opposition as a means to weaken forward operating bases. This places a significant price on every ounce of fuel required to be consumed in theater.

ACT has developed a high energy efficiency ratio (EER) ECU to minimize electrical energy consumption for applications that require improved efficiency. The ECU employs a number of techniques commonly used in commercial HVAC units, with a focus on the level of ruggedization required for military applications. Digital compressors, air economizers, and reduced pressure drop evaporator and condenser coils are just some of the technologies employed in the unit to maximize the EER. The result is a highly ruggedized, military ECU that rivals some of the best commercial HVAC systems in energy efficiency.
